What companies run services between Sydney, NSW, Australia and Comboyne, NSW, Australia?

NSW TrainLink operates a bus from Central Station, Forecourt, Coach Bay 1 to Wauchope Station, Coach Stop 3 times a day. Tickets cost $30–45 and the journey takes 6h 25m. Alternatively, NSW TrainLink XPT operates a train from Central Station to Wauchope Station twice a week. Tickets cost $35–190 and the journey takes 6h 26m.
